The stand-alone seasons will only include weapons present in the original episode, however they will still have their reworked CIU mechanics. And there will be other differences, too (e.g. unlockables, CI5 mission progress)
Besides, even if the seasons were identical to the CIU DLCs, there is still a business benefit to having them also available separately. As DLC, the episodes are simply never going to be as discoverable as stand-alone SKUs.
Having said this, I still haven’t made a final decision.
